    Any time I head out of town (Huntsville), I try to find a local pastry and/or coffee shop…read more Visiting Birmingham, I had all lot of options; Continental wound up being the call for pastries. Nestled in the Mountain Brook area, it's a little hard to see but is right next to Chez Lulu, which I think is a sister restaurant. Parking is a little tricky but manageable. I got there fairly late so the selection was a bit picked over, but I still got a good array of treats to bring home. Service was a touch slow but friendly. They were fairly busy. There's no room to eat inside or outside that I could discern; it's exclusively a take and go type of place. I got two pecan sandies to share with my parents, who were along for the ride, and then a cardamom bun and a peanut butter cookie for later. Sadly, I don't feel like any of the pastries really wowed. The pecan sandies were a little too dry (even as sandies go) and the pecans didn't taste toasted nor were they especially plentiful. The peanut butter cookie was the best thing, though it too was a little on the dry side - nice PB flavor though. I straight up didn't like the cardamom bun. The cardamom flavor was completely overwhelming, to the point it wasn't sweet at all, and instead tasted almost medicinal. The texture was nice but I couldn't finish it. Perhaps I arrived too late to order their specialties. I know they specialize in European goodies so if I return I'll make sure to try a croissant or something similar.

    I work in downtown Birmingham and this location in the Financial Center is one of our favorite…read moreplaces for lunch. My coworker and I ate here Thursday, 02/01/24 for lunch. Soon as you walk in, you see packaged desserts in both full cakes and slices. They had several King Cakes, so we immediately decided to split a slice. Decided that first before what we're actually eating. #priorities Last time I ate here, I got the Chicken Quesadilla and it was so good. But a couple of my coworkers got the Marilyn Monroe, a sandwich with "turkey, pepperoni, mozzarella & marinara sauce on cheddar bread". So I went with that this time, same as my coworker. Concept here is that you order at the counter, they give you a number to display on your table, then another server will bring your order. Service was fast. The sandwich looked a bit small at first, but it was stacked with turkey and pepperoni, so the portion size was actually just right. It comes with marinara sauce on the side for dipping, which is good, because it keeps the sandwich from being too messy, but it was a bit odd because it was cold, in combination with the warm sandwich. I kinda wish the sauce had been warmer. It comes with a bag of chips and your choice of another side, which I chose fruit. I don't care for melon, so I picked around that and ate the grapes out. Next time I might get another side. And finally... it was King Cake time. We had picked a cream cheese slice and it was SO good. Had a cinnamon taste mixed in, but to be fair, this was my first King Cake so I actually have no idea what to compare it to. This dessert made me so happy. Two things I need to figure out: why is this sandwich called the Marilyn Monroe and when can we eat here again.
